1) Input validation error

EUVDB-ID: #VU32677

Risk: Medium

CVSSv3.1: 6.4 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:L/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2013-2053

CWE-ID: CWE-20 - Improper input validation

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ows remote attackers to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input. A remote attacker can cause a denial of service (pluto IKE daemon cr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via crafted DNS TXT records.

Mitigation

Update the affected packages:

i686:
    openswan-doc-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.i686
    openswan-debuginfo-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.i686
    openswan-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.i686

src:
    openswan-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.src

x86_64:
    openswan-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.x86_64
    openswan-debuginfo-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.x86_64
    openswan-doc-2.6.37-2.16.amzn1.x86_64
